What they do

An Electrician works on electrical systems in buildings. Installs electrical wiring and lighting in new construction, and repairs or upgrade wiring, outlets or other parts of older electrical systems. Checks safety and makes installations or repairs that are in compliance with local building codes. May also specialize in electrical work required in different manufacturing industries, electrical systems for cars, plane or boats, or electrical and lighting work in the film industry.

Company Description About Sika With more than 100 years of experience, Sika is a worldwide innovation and sustainability leader in the development and production of systems and products for commercial and residential construction, as well as the transportation, marine, automotive, and renewable energy manufacturing industries. Sika is a specialty chemicals company with a globally leading position in the development and production of systems and products for bonding, sealing, damping, reinforcing, and protection in the building sector and industry. Sika has subsidiaries in 103 countries around the world, produces in over 400 factories, and develops innovative technologies for customers worldwide. In doing so, it plays a crucial role in enabling the transformation of the construction and transportation industries toward greater environmental compatibility. billion in sales in 2025 Job Description Layout, installation and maintenance on a variety of industrial process equipment and plant infrastructure. Establishes secondary distribution centers, balance loads, and wire complicated circuits. Makes repairs involving disassembling units and replacing/troubleshooting electrical control circuits. Makes diagnoses to replace or repair parts and make adjustments. Inspects machinery to insure proper operation. Oversees major amount of work required for each electrical project. Troubleshoots PLC's and is able to modify programs. Orders parts and writes reports as needed. Performs all minor welding. Performs all other skills required of other specialists. Qualifications Ability to design and install electronic control circuits. Understands national electrical code and safety lock out/tag out procedures. Must be able to plan and perform unusual and difficult work where only general methods are available. Moderate physical effort; frequently moving lightweight material in difficult work positions. Thorough knowledge of electrical logic. Ability to perform general air conditioning service work. Able and willing to attend school/seminars of specialized trade. Must have high school diploma or equivalent. Must have excellent oral and written communication skills. Requires 5 years experience in general maintenance with 3 years being Electrical specific.
